Comprehending the Types of Exercise Bicycles

Exercise bikes been available in different designs, accommodating different physical fitness levels and choices. Below is a table showcasing the primary types of exercise bikes readily available on the market.

Kind Of Exercise BicycleDescriptionIdeal ForPrice Range
Upright BikeMimics the feel of a traditional bicycle.General fitness enthusiasts₤ 200 - ₤ 700
Recumbent BikeFeatures a bigger seat and back assistance, appropriate for reclining.Novices, senior citizens, or those with back problems₤ 300 - ₤ 1,200
Spin BikeDesigned for high-intensity interval training (HIIT) with a heavy flywheel.Advanced users & & spin classes₤ 300 - ₤ 2,000
Folding BikeCompact and portable, perfect for little spaces.Those with limited area₤ 150 - ₤ 600
Hybrid BikeIntegrates functions of upright and recumbent bikes.Versatile users desiring choices₤ 250 - ₤ 1,000

Benefits of Using an Exercise Bicycle

Using an exercise bicycle offers numerous health benefits, making it an important addition to any physical fitness program. Here are some of the primary advantages:

  1. Cardiovascular Fitness: Regular biking enhances heart health, increases lung capability, and boosts overall cardio endurance.

  2. Weight Management: Cycling burns calories effectively, assisting in weight-loss or upkeep when integrated with a well balanced diet plan.

  3. Low Impact Exercise: Unlike running or high-impact sports, cycling places less strain on the joints, making it a perfect option for those with injuries or chronic discomfort.

  4. Muscle Toning: It helps tone the lower body muscles, consisting of the quadriceps, hamstrings, calves, and glutes.

  5. Convenience: The ability to cycle indoors at any time removes weather-related barriers and time restraints.

  6. Mental Health Benefits: Regular physical activity releases endorphins, improving mood, lowering stress and anxiety, and improving overall psychological health.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ions About Exercise Bicycles

Q1: How long should I utilize my exercise bicycle daily?

A: For ideal health benefits, go for a minimum of 30 minutes of moderate-intensity cycling most days of the week.

Q2: Can utilizing an exercise bicycle assist with weight loss?

A: Yes, when integrated with a healthy diet plan, biking can successfully aid with weight loss due to its calorie-burning capacity.

Q3: Is an exercise bicycle appropriate for beginners?

A: Absolutely! Exercise bikes can be adjusted for various resistance levels, making them appropriate for beginners and advanced users alike.

Q4: Do I require any special equipment to use an exercise bicycle?

A: While special biking shoes can boost performance, comfortable exercise attire and encouraging shoes are generally enough.

Q5: How do I maintain my exercise bicycle?

A: Regular upkeep involves cleaning the bike, lubing the chain (if applicable), and looking for loose parts and suitable tension in the resistance system.

Q6: Can I use an exercise bicycle for rehab purposes?

A: Yes, many physiotherapists advise stationary bicycles as a part of rehabilitation programs due to their low-impact nature.
